The Sheath and Retention System


The knife is housed in a black, seemingly Kydex-style sheath, which provides excellent retention. The sheath's design, with its integrated green finger ring, mirrors the knife's own handle, creating a cohesive carry solution. This material choice is significant.

Kydex-style sheaths are renowned for their positive retention and durability, ensuring the blade remains securely in place during active movement. The audible 'click' when seating the knife provides immediate feedback that it is locked in, preventing accidental deployment. This system is crucial for safety and confidence when carrying a sharp, fixed blade.

Many entry-level fixed blades come with flimsy nylon or plastic sheaths that offer poor retention, leading to potential loss or injury. This sheath, by contrast, appears engineered for security, a critical factor for any EDC item. It mitigates the common problem of blades rattling loose or falling out during daily activities.

Blade Profile and Edge Geometry


The blade itself features a drop-point or modified sheepsfoot profile, characterized by a robust belly and a strong, usable tip. The cutting edge appears to be a plain edge, optimized for clean cuts without the snagging associated with serrations. The blade length, as indicated by the ruler in the image, is approximately 4cm (1.57 inches).

This blade geometry is highly practical for an EDC tool. The broad belly excels at slicing, making it ideal for opening boxes, preparing food, or stripping insulation. The tip, while not needle-sharp, appears strong enough for piercing tasks, offering a good balance between utility and durability. A plain edge is also easier to sharpen and maintain for most users.

Compared to blades with aggressive tactical profiles or excessive serrations, this design prioritizes everyday utility. It is less intimidating and more universally applicable. The short blade length is also advantageous for legality in many jurisdictions, making it a more accessible EDC choice for a wider audience.

Material Considerations and Maintenance


While the specific steel type is not disclosed, the visual finish suggests a common stainless variant, likely 440C or a similar alloy. These steels offer good corrosion resistance, which is vital for a knife carried close to the body, where it can be exposed to sweat and moisture. Proper maintenance, including regular cleaning and occasional oiling, will preserve its integrity.

Stainless steels are generally easier to sharpen than super steels, making this knife more user-friendly for routine edge upkeep. A simple ceramic rod or fine grit stone can maintain a working edge. This practicality ensures the knife remains functional for its intended purpose over time, without requiring specialized sharpening equipment.

Many high-end EDC knives boast exotic super steels, which offer superior edge retention but come with a significant cost premium and increased sharpening difficulty. For the average user, a well-executed stainless steel blade provides ample performance for daily tasks at a much more approachable price point. This knife embodies that sensible trade-off.
